Remote IO boards operate continuously while the placement machine is running. Long production hours, electrical aging, contamination, vibration, connector deterioration, or improper handling may gradually affect board performance.
Typical situations that may lead to inspection or replacement include:
| Possible Cause | Possible Effect |
|---|---|
| Long-term continuous operation | Electronic component aging |
| Unstable electrical connection | Intermittent IO communication |
| Connector contamination | Poor signal contact |
| Excessive dust | Reduced board reliability |
| Improper installation | Communication or connection errors |
| Mechanical vibration | Loose connector or unstable contact |
| Electrical abnormality | Board malfunction or alarm |
| Previous repair damage | Unstable machine operation |
When an NXT III M6 machine reports IO-related abnormalities, technicians should inspect the complete control circuit before replacing the board.
The board should not automatically be considered defective only because an IO alarm appears. Cables, connectors, power supply conditions, related sensors, and connected devices should also be checked.

The Remote IO Board forms part of the machine's distributed control system.
During machine operation, multiple devices continuously provide input signals and receive output commands. These signals allow the machine controller to monitor operating conditions and coordinate different functions.
The Remote IO Board provides an interface between the machine control system and connected field devices.
A simplified signal process can be described as:
Machine Device -> Input Signal -> Remote IO Board -> Machine Controller -> Control Command -> Remote IO Board -> Output Device
This communication process occurs continuously during production.
Stable IO communication helps the machine correctly recognize device status and execute control commands according to the programmed operating sequence.
If communication becomes unstable, the machine may detect an abnormal condition and stop production to protect the equipment or production process.
